Mariya Gabriel: We support Bulgarian Sunday schools and are proud of the talent in them

Deputy Prime Minister and Minister of Foreign Affairs Mariya Gabriel and Minister of Education and Science Galin Tsokov announced a new initiative - more than 300 computer configurations will be provided to Bulgarian Sunday schools abroad. The campaign is the idea of Mariya Gabriel and aims to contribute to the renewal of the technical base and support the development of digital skills of students.

Fifth meeting under the Political Consultation Mechanism between the Ministries of Foreign Affairs of Bulgaria and Mexico

The fifth meeting under the Political Consultation Mechanism between Bulgaria and Mexico took place on 23 January 2024 in Mexico City. The Bulgarian delegation was led by Mr. Tihomir Stoychev, Deputy Minister of Foreign Affairs, and the Mexican delegation by Ms. Jennifer Feller, Acting Deputy Minister in the Secretariat for Foreign Relations.

Minister of Foreign Affairs of the Republic of Turkey Hakan Fidan will visit Bulgaria at the invitation of Deputy Prime Minister and Minister of Foreign Affairs Mariya Gabriel

On 30 January the Minister of Foreign Affairs of the Republic of Turkey Hakan Fidan will pay an official visit to Bulgaria at the invitation of the Deputy Prime Minister and Minister of Foreign Affairs Mariya Gabriel. The programme of the visit includes a bilateral meeting with Deputy Prime Minister Gabriel and plenary talks between the two delegations. Topical issues on the bilateral and international agenda will be discussed.

Mariya Gabriel: Cooperation at national and international level will contribute to good practices and sustainable solutions in the fight against trafficking in human beings

Deputy Prime Minister and Minister of Foreign Affairs Mariya Gabriel hosted a National Conference ‘Preventing and Combating Trafficking in Human Beings: good practices and sustainable solutions’. The opening was attended by the Minister of the Interior Kalin Stoyanov and the EU Anti-Trafficking Coordinator Diane Schmitt. The aim of the conference was to show that Bulgaria contributes significantly and decisively in the fight against Trafficking in Human Beings.
